The estates general were recruited in May of 1789. There were 3 classes represented by the estates general, the nobles, the clergy, and the rest of the population called 3rd estate.
-
An angry crowd marched in east Paris as a sign against King Louis XVI. The crowd had angry, unemployed civilians who had no food and money.
-
The declaration of human rights is written which states that all men are equal under the law. The thing is, women and children were not supported by this document.
-
A large crowd of women marched from Paris to Palace of Versailles because they were in disagreement with the luxurious lifestyle of the king and nobles. They broke into the quarters of Queen Marie Antoinette.
-
The national assembly decided to impose limits on the king's authority, the restrictions were against King Louis XVI and Marie Antoinette. The royal family left Paris without making any news about it. They got a few miles away until they were recognized at the border and forced to go back.
-
France was proclaimed a constitutional monarchy and the national assembly was dissolved and replaced by the legislative assembly. Members of the national assembly were not able to be in the new parlament.
-
French Government is against Austrian army. The king is viewed as a traitor for attempting to leave the country and escape behind the legislative assembly' s back. The revolution is trying to move into a more radical fase.
